Fifty years since the Eagle landed

The landing module “Eagle” of NASA’s Apollo 11 mission touched down in the lunar dust of the Sea of Tranquility at 20:18:15 UTC on July 20th in 1969. We’re counting down to the 50th anniversary of that touchdown!

Proudly powered by WordPress | Theme: Baskerville 2 by Anders Noren.

Up ↑